Rahmon and Raisi discuss current situation in Afghanistan in Samarkand

On September 15, the leader of the Republic of Tajikistan Emomali Rahmon met with IRI President Sayyid Ebrahim Raisi in Samarkand. The interlocutors discussed multifaceted cooperation between the two countries, the press office of the President of Tajikistan reports.

They noted the growth in commodity turnover between Tajikistan and Iran, which amounted to over $116 million in the first six months of the year. Last year, trade between Tajikistan and Iran amounted to $120 million.

The interlocutors focused on enhancing bilateral cooperation in the trade, economic, industrial, agricultural, energy, transport, communications, cultural and humanitarian sectors.

The President of Tajikistan supported the initiative to set up a joint working group to use the transit potential of the two countries and boost cooperation between the regions of Tajikistan and Iran.

The interlocutors discussed urgent issues on the agenda, including the situation in Afghanistan.

As was reported, Rahmon arrived in Uzbekistan to participate in the SCO Summit. It is planned to submit more than 30 documents for signing at the Summit.
